Spotting Typical iPhone Problems: Symptoms You Should Never Ignore

Recognizing typical iPhone issues requires vigilance and awareness of various symptoms that may indicate underlying issues. People need to stay alert to symptoms including persistent app shutdowns, which may suggest software conflicts or insufficient memory. A rapidly draining battery can signal a failing battery or excessive background activity. Furthermore, when the phone becomes excessively hot during normal operation, it could result from hardware failures or inefficiently developed applications.

Physical signs, such as a cracked screen or unresponsive buttons, demand urgent action to stop further deterioration. Network issues, including wireless or Bluetooth malfunctions, commonly point to network settings that need resetting or hardware defects. Additionally, odd noises while on calls or operating the speaker may point to speaker-related defects. Through early identification of these signs, customers can evaluate their repair alternatives wisely, which may result in saving both time and money over time.

How to Pick the Ideal Repair Service for Your iPhone

When seeking the best service provider for your iPhone, users should consider some essential criteria to secure a satisfactory experience. To begin, reputation plays a vital role; checking online reviews and feedback can provide insights into the reliability and quality of service. Additionally, it's important to verify the qualifications of the technicians, ensuring they are certified and experienced in iPhone repairs.

Furthermore, ask about guarantees on repair work to protect against upcoming complications. Access to authentic components is a further essential aspect; employing authentic components can extend the durability of the equipment. Pricing transparency is essential, as hidden fees can cause dissatisfaction. In addition, convenience factors like location and turnaround time ought to be considered as well. Through thorough evaluation of these factors, customers can reach a well-informed choice and select a repair service that addresses their requirements efficiently.

Tool Availability

The access to proper tools greatly impacts the choice to pursue DIY iPhone repairs. For individuals who possess the necessary tools, such as spudgers, suction cups, and precision screwdrivers, basic repairs including screen replacements and battery swaps can be manageable. However, lacking the right tools may turn even straightforward tasks into challenges, resulting in frustration or additional damage.

Conversely, individuals facing complex issues or lacking tools would benefit from professional assistance. Technicians possess advanced equipment and expertise to address intricate problems, providing reliable and safe outcomes. At the end of the day, the determination rests on the nature of the problem and the accessibility of suitable equipment, directing individuals to choose between a do-it-yourself solution or enlisting expert assistance for optimal outcomes.

Typical Repair Cost Ranges

Repairing an iPhone can often seem like navigating a complex financial landscape, with costs varying considerably based on the kind of damage and iPhone model. Screen replacements typically cost between $100 to $300, according to the specific iPhone version, with newer models commanding higher prices. Battery replacements usually fall between $50 and $100, while more serious concerns, such as motherboard repairs or water damage, can escalate costs to $300 or more. In addition, fixes for charging port or camera problems can fall between $150 to $250. Users should also consider applicable diagnostic costs, which may add to the overall expense. Knowing these general price ranges can help iPhone owners anticipate repair costs and make informed decisions.

Factors Influencing Repair Costs

Although multiple factors are at work, the version of the iPhone is a major factor of repair costs. Newer models typically command higher repair prices due to advanced technology and components. Furthermore, the type of the damage heavily impacts costs; damage like broken screens may cost less to address compared to moisture damage or logic board issues. The supply of parts also is a crucial factor; hard-to-find components may drive up prices. In addition, the decision of repair service—whether authorized or independent—impacts costs, with certified providers typically commanding higher fees for their skill and guarantee. To conclude, location can affect prices, as urban areas may have higher labor rates compared to rural settings. Being aware of these elements allows customers to better plan for repair costs.

Warranty Repairs vs. Third-Party Services: Choosing the Best Option

Deciding between warranty repairs and third-party services can be a challenging decision for iPhone owners. Manufacturer-backed repairs, generally supplied by Apple or approved service providers, guarantee that original parts are used and maintain the device's warranty status. These options often deliver reliable service but might include lengthier turnaround times and increased expenses.

That said, outside repair providers can offer speedier and budget-friendly alternatives. However, choosing non-certified repair services may compromise your existing warranty protection, and the level of parts quality and proficiency can differ significantly. Individuals should take care to assess the underlying concerns related to independent repair services, such as the likelihood of inadequate components or inadequate service.

At the end of the day, the decision is determined by the individual's preferences—whether they prioritize warranty preservation and quality assurance or desire cost-effective, faster repair options. Evaluating individual circumstances can assist in making this critical decision.

Frequently Asked Questions

How Long Does an Average iPhone Repair Take?

An average iPhone repair typically takes between one and two hours, subject to the nature of the problem and the expertise of the technician. Repairs that are more involved, such as water damage issues, could take longer to allow for a detailed assessment and full restoration.

Can I Use My iPhone While It's Being Repaired?

During iPhone repairs, users usually find themselves unable to access their device. Most repairs necessitate that the phone be turned off or disassembled, making its features inaccessible until the technician completes the necessary work.

What Tools Do You Need for DIY iPhone Repairs?

Fundamental tools required for DIY iPhone repairs comprise a precision screwdriver set, a spudger, tweezers, a suction cup, and a heat gun. Such tools support safe disassembly, precise component handling, and successful reassembly, ensuring effective repairs while minimizing potential damage.

Is It Safe to Repair My iPhone in Humid Conditions?

Fixing an iPhone in moist conditions is typically unsafe. Moisture can compromise the internal hardware, resulting in further problems. It is recommended to operate in a controlled environment to ensure successful repairs and avoid potential complications.

How Do I Back up My iPhone Prior to Repairs?

To create a backup of an iPhone prior to repairs, you can take advantage of iCloud by turning on the backup options or attach the device to a computer and employ iTunes or Finder, guaranteeing that all data is safely preserved.
